Standard adaption syndrome, such as three degrees: (1) alarm, (2) resistance, and (three) exhaustion.
Alarm, combat, or flight, is the instantaneous response of the frame to 'perceived' strain.
This syndrome is divided into the alarm reaction level, resistance stage, and exhaustion level.
The alarm response level refers back to the initial signs of the frame below acute stress and the "combat or flight" response.
